Biography
Name
James Redway
Birth
10 JAN 1678 Rehoboth, Bristol, Massachusetts
Marriage
She married james Redway 18 Aug 1719, in Rehoboth.[1] (VR, 2:135).
Married (second) Mary Whipple, of Cumberland, Rhode Island) on 14 Apr 1748 in Rehoboth, Bristol County, Massachusetts (Ref: Early Vital Records of Bristol County Massachusetts to About 1850, Search & Research Publishing, Wheatridge, CO 80033, 1998, 2002, Rehoboth Marriages & Intentions, p. 319). James "Redeway" was a Captain who served under Major Bradford (Ref: [2]
Death
30 MAY 1760 Rehoboth, Bristol, Massachusetts
Burial
Palm River Churchyard Cemetery, Rehoboth, Bristol, Massachusetts.
